mon⋅ey⋅man

[muhn-ee-man]
–noun, plural -men.
1. an investor; angel; backer.
2. a person responsible for managing money or financial arrangements of a business, institution, etc.

Origin:
1565–75; money + man 1

mon·ey·man   (mŭn'ē-mān')   
n.   Informal
  1. A man who assesses or advises on economic policies and trends.

  2. A man who manages the financial aspect of a business or an operation.
